Écrasés (en. Crushed)

/ekʁa.Se/

Meaning & Definition

EnglishFrench
adjective
That has been crushed, flattened.
The crushed apples are used to make sauce.
Les pommes écrasées servent à faire une compote.
Referring to a person who is very tired or downcast.
After this workday, I feel completely crushed.
Après cette journée de travail, je me sens complètement écrasé.
